What Is a Multipoint Door Lock?
A multipoint door lock is a sophisticated locking mechanism that operates at numerous points along the frame of a door. This means that when the secret is turned or the handle is pulled, bolts extend from different put on the lock, protecting the door at a number of points rather than simply one. This system supplies superior security as it makes it extremely difficult for burglars to require their way in.

Before elimination, examine your existing multipoint door lock. Take notes on its measurements and how it is installed. This info will help you pick the right replacement lock.
Action 2: Remove the Existing LockLoosen the Handle: Start by eliminating the screws securing the garage door lock replacement handle.Get rid of the Lock: Unscrew and get rid of the faceplate that holds the lock in location. Focus on the positioning of each part as you disassemble it.Extract the Locking Mechanism: Once the trim runs out sight, thoroughly pull the lock out from the door piece.Step 3: Prepare for New Lock InstallationClean the area completely to make sure that there's no particles that might disrupt the new lock.If needed, use wood glue or silicone to make sure that any gaps left over from the previous rim lock replacement are filled out.Step 4: Install the New LockInsert the New Mechanism: Align the new locking mechanism into the cavity of the door.Secure the Lock: Use screws to secure the new lock in location. Ensure it is lined up properly utilizing a level.Install the Handle: Reattach the handle door locks, guaranteeing all screws are tight and secure.Step 5: Test the Lock
Before finishing up, check the lock. Make sure all points engage and disengage appropriately. Make any needed adjustments and verify the fit.

To extend the life of your new multipoint door lock, consider the following maintenance pointers:
Regular Cleaning: Clean the lock and its parts to prevent dirt build-up.Lubrication: Use a silicone-based lube periodically on all moving parts.Inspect Annually: Check for wear, misalignment, or any functional issues.Frequently Asked Questions about Multipoint Door Lock Replacement
